Chairman

Mr. William Sumas is Chairman of the Board, Executive Vice President of the Company, since December 15, 2017. He was appointed Chairman of the Board of Directors in 2017 and had served as Vice Chairman of the Board since 2009. He has served as Vice President and a Director of the Company since 1980. Since 1989, he has served as an Executive Vice President. He has responsibility for real estate development. William Sumas is a member of Wakeferns Environmental, Government Relations, and Sanitation, Safety and Appearance Committees. He recently served as Chairman of the New Jersey Food Council for 8 years. The Board concluded that William Sumas should continue to serve as a Director of the Company in part due to his extensive knowledge of Wakefern, the Company, the local real estate environment and governmental matters obtained over his 49 year career with the Company. since 2017.

Village Super Market, Inc. operates a chain of supermarkets in the United States. Village Super Market, Inc. was founded in 1937 and is based in Springfield, New Jersey. Village Super operates under Grocery Stores classification in the United States and is traded on NASDAQ Exchange. It employs 2225 people. Village Super Market (VLGEA) is traded on NASDAQ Exchange in USA. It is located in 733 Mountain Avenue, Springfield, NJ, United States, 07081 and employs 2,170 people.
